Mold Risks for Babies and Young Children

Children are not small adults. Their exposure is higher and their airways are still developing.

Why Children Are More Vulnerable

Infants and young children breathe more air relative to their body weight than adults do, so an equivalent airborne concentration delivers a proportionally larger dose.

They also spend far more time on and near the floor, where settled spores concentrate, and they put hands and objects in their mouths. Their respiratory and immune systems are still developing.

What To Watch For

Persistent cough, congestion, or wheezing that does not follow a normal illness course. Symptoms that improve when the child is away from home — at daycare, at a grandparent's house, on vacation — and return afterward.

Recurrent respiratory infections or a new pattern of nighttime coughing are also worth mentioning to a pediatrician, particularly if the home has known dampness.

The Asthma Connection

This is the most important point. Public health reviews have found evidence associating indoor dampness and mold with asthma development in children, not only with worsening existing asthma.

For a family with a damp home and a child showing early respiratory symptoms, that is a strong reason to address the moisture rather than wait and see.

Do Not Let Fear Drive the Decision

Parents encounter a great deal of alarming material about mold online, much of it from companies selling testing. The well-supported risks — allergic symptoms, asthma effects — are real and worth acting on. The claims of severe systemic illness in healthy children are not well supported.

Take it seriously, act on the moisture, talk to your pediatrician, and be skeptical of anyone whose diagnosis conveniently matches what they are selling.
